The Company Overview:


My client is a well-established NFP social housing association who provide affordable housing and services across Warrington to families, older people and people with additional needs.

Their aim is to help make Warrington a great place to live and somewhere the potential of individuals and communities can be realised.


They are actively seeking a new Head of Finance to help develop and deliver on the financial aspects of the Association's business plan.

The successful applicant will proactively lead the Finance team, shape the direction of the department and ensure economic, efficient and effective delivery of customer services.

Contributing to the overall direction and leadership of the Association, this person will also play an active role as a member of the Senior Management Team (SMT)

Your new role as Head of Finance:

Your duties will include:

  • Work in partnership with other SMT members to deliver on objectives and ensure the effective day to day running of the organisation
  • Overall responsibility for the preparation and production of timely and accurate management accounts and forecasts
  • Overall responsibility for the production and publication of annual financial statements.
  • Key point of contact for the external audit process.
  • Working with SMT colleagues to research, prepare and submit periodic budgets and to prepare and deliver reports as required.
  • Ensure the accurate & timely production and submission of returns to a range of stakeholders including lenders, HMRC, pensions, auditors, Regulator of Social Housing etc.
  • Regular monitoring of the Association's Treasury Strategy
  • To manage all aspects of the Association's insurance requirements.
  • Management of reviews, projects and initiatives to support continuous improvement of the Finance function
  • Oversee and maintain all policies and procedures related to financial management
  • Lead responsibility and line management of all Finance colleagues and resources.
  • To actively model the values of the Association and inspire excellence in others
  • Work with the SMT to provide effective, collaborative and motivational leadership, within a culture that coaches and engages people to make the most of their skills and talents
  • Manage and develop effective relationships with key stakeholders from third, public and private sectors
